Taitu in Addis Abeba
  • Tip Rating:
  • Satisfaction:
  • Taitu is one of the oldest hotels in Addis. It was built at the beginning of the 20th century... and seems that ever refurbished since then!. It is in fact a nice colonial building but overall a bit abandoned and the standard is rather low in comfort and so. But it makes a good option for a stay in Addis. Though I found it a bit overpriced for what you get.
    I slept there on my first night. I arrived late (22h) and my first option (Baro Hotel) was full, so unless I wanted to wander around endlessly that night (and I swear I didn't, after all those hours in a plane), my only chance was to take a "less than simple" room at the new wing of the Taitu for 130 Birr (about 13 USD). There was no running water then (general water supplies problems they said), but I didn't care as I had to take a bus at 6 the next morning.
    The area around is lively at night (too lively sometimes) with local bars and brothels, but is a safe area.

    Africa Hotel in Axum
  • Tip Rating:
  • Satisfaction:
  • I stayed in Axum 2 days, both in this hotel, but in different rooms. I arrived here following my LP guide, in a minibus from Gonder.
    First night they only had "shared bathroom" rooms. 30Birr (3 USD). These are pretty basic and the bathroom / showers are "too basic", if you know what I mean... But it was late, I was tired, so why not?
    But the following day I changed to a "private bathroom" room, one of those that are in the courtyard (see pic). Those are really something very different, and the price difference is not big (5 USD instead of 3). There is hot water and the rooms are big and bright.
    So if you come and there is a chance take the "private WC" ones.
    There is a restaurant too.
